It's our College and University students' time to shine! The Student Spotlight Awards launched in 2019, to celebrate outstanding success. By popular demand, we'll be making the awards an annual occurrence and asking members of our teaching and support staff to identify students who really go the extra mile.

Many of our students achieve success beyond their studies and use their time at Writtle to take their first strides into the workplace. The University College is delighted to support the establishment of professional networks and entrepreneurial initiatives. Staff are recognising achievements beyond the classroom by nominating learners who excel in one of the following fields:

  • Community Excellence: Transforming lives by helping or representing others in the community
  • Extracurricular Excellence: Achieving personal success outside of their studies
  • Enterprise Excellence: Founding an entrepreneurial venture or establishing innovative careers connections

2019's Student of the Year, Kaile Sherry, excelled in two separate categories, Enterprise Excellence and Extracurricular Excellence, after displaying exceptional commitment, organisational abilities and subject knowledge.

She said: "I was really honoured to be nominated twice. I tried to make the most of every opportunity I received at Writtle throughout my studies, course related and externally. It felt incredible to have my work acknowledged by the institution. Not only was it great to be recognised, to me it was something else that would really improve my CV!"
